Linux RAID控制器驱动下载:megaraid_sas-**.***.**.**

需积分: 1 4 下载量 157 浏览量 更新于2024-10-28 1 收藏 134KB GZ 举报
资源摘要信息:"本资源是一个开源的磁盘阵列控制器驱动程序,名为megaraid-sas-**.***.**.**-src.tar.gz。该驱动程序主要针对使用LSI Logic SAS芯片组的RAID卡。RAID(冗余磁盘阵列)卡是一种硬件设备,用于将多个磁盘驱动器组合成一个逻辑单元,以提高数据存储的性能、可靠性和容错能力。根据描述,该压缩包内含有源代码文件,可以进行下载并编译安装在相应的操作系统上。 RAID卡通过硬件级别的逻辑运算来管理多个硬盘的工作,与操作系统无关。它能够提供多种RAID配置,如RAID 0、RAID 1、RAID 5、RAID 6和RAID 10等,每种配置都有其特定的数据冗余和性能特性。 以下是对该文件更深入的知识点解析: 1. RAID卡与驱动程序 RAID卡是连接在服务器主板和硬盘驱动器之间的硬件设备,用于管理硬盘驱动器的工作,并提供数据冗余。驱动程序是RAID卡与操作系统交互的软件接口,允许操作系统控制RAID卡,并将其作为本地硬盘使用。 2. LSI Logic SAS芯片组 LSI Logic(现在是Avago Technologies的一部分)是知名的存储解决方案提供商,其SAS(Serial Attached SCSI)芯片组是业界广泛使用的一种用于创建高性能和高可靠性的RAID系统的芯片组。SAS技术提供高速的数据传输速度,并支持热插拔功能。 3. RAID配置及级别 RAID卡支持多种RAID级别,每种级别的目标和优势各有不同,例如: - RAID 0(条带化):提高读写性能,但不提供数据冗余。 - RAID 1(镜像):提供数据冗余,至少需要两个硬盘。 - RAID 5(带奇偶校验的条带化):提供性能提升和一定的数据冗余。 - RAID 6(带双奇偶校验的条带化):类似于RAID 5,但使用双奇偶校验提供更多冗余。 - RAID 10(1+0,镜像+条带化):结合了RAID 1和RAID 0的优势,提供高性能和高冗余。 4. 编译安装开源驱动程序 开源驱动程序通常以源代码形式提供,需要用户具备相应的编译环境和操作系统的知识才能安装。编译安装过程通常包括下载源代码包、解压、配置编译环境、编译源代码以及将编译后的模块安装到系统中。 5. 兼容性与更新 开源驱动程序的更新能够修复已知的错误,提升性能,以及增加对新硬件的支持。用户需要定期检查更新,以确保与操作系统和RAID卡硬件的最佳兼容性。 6. 操作系统支持 该驱动程序预计支持多种操作系统,包括但不限于Windows Server、Linux以及各种Unix变种。用户在下载和安装前,应确保驱动程序与所使用的操作系统版本兼容。 7. 系统管理与监控 安装RAID驱动后,用户通常可以使用特定的管理工具来监控RAID阵列的状态,进行故障诊断,以及配置RAID阵列参数。这些工具可能包括命令行工具和图形用户界面应用程序。 总结来说,本资源是一套开源的RAID卡驱动程序,提供了对LSI Logic SAS芯片组RAID卡的支持,支持不同的RAID级别,并需要用户具备一定的编译安装技能。在使用此驱动程序时,用户应关注其兼容性、性能优化以及安全更新,并定期检查以确保最佳的系统运行状态。"